Best Construction Supervisor Job Description Samples

A construction supervisor is responsible for the day-to-day operations of a construction site. They must ensure that all work is performed safely, on schedule, and within budget. Construction supervisors typically have experience working in the construction industry as carpenters, electricians, plumbers, or other trades people. The construction supervisor role is a critical one, as they are responsible for ensuring the safety of all workers on site and for coordinating the work of sub-contractors.

In order to be successful in this role, construction supervisors must have excellent communication and organizational skills.

Duties and Responsibilities Of Construction Supervisor:

The construction supervisor job description includes the following duties and responsibilities:

  • Overseeing the day-to-day operations of a construction site
  • Ensuring that the project is completed on time, within budget, and to the required specifications
  • Ensuring the safety of all workers on site
  • Coordinating the work of sub-contractors
  • Communicating with clients, architects, engineers, and other professionals as required
  • Reviewing plans and drawings to ensure that they are accurate and comply with all relevant codes and regulations
  • Resolving any problems that arise during construction
  • Prepare reports as required

Construction Supervisor Salary:

  • The average salary for a construction supervisor is $85,000 per year. Salaries will vary depending on experience, education, and location.
